Here are some top editing software for Chromebook:

1. Google Docs

Google Docs is a basic word processing application that comes free with every Chromebook. It offers a range of editing tools including formatting options, spell Check, comment feature, and version history. While it lacks more advanced features such as robust design and layout tools, it is perfect for basic editing tasks. Moreover, it offers easy collaboration and sharing options.

2. Grammarly

Grammarly is a writing app that helps improve grammar, spelling, and punctuation. It offers suggestions for sentence structure and wording as well. The app offers a Chrome extension that works seamlessly with Google Docs, making editing effortless. However, the premium version offers more advanced features.

3. Hemingway

Hemingway is an app designed to help writers simplify their work by detecting and highlighting long and complex sentences, passive voice, and adverbs. It offers suggestions for making writing more concise and effective. It offers a desktop version that works perfectly on Chromebooks.

4. Canva

Canva is a graphic design app that allows users to create professional-looking documents, posters, and social media posts. It offers a range of templates, layouts, and stock images to choose from. While it is primarily designed for graphic design, it also offers basic text editing features.

5. Writer

Writer is an online writing app designed for creating long-form content such as articles, reports, and research papers. It offers a range of writing and editing tools such as highlighting, tagging, themes, and more. The interface is clean and minimalist, which makes it perfect for writers.

6. Pixlr

Pixlr is an image editing app that works perfectly on Chromebooks. It offers a range of features including cropping, resizing, filters, and more. While it may not have the same level of functionality as Photoshop, it is perfect for basic image editing tasks.

  • How do I install editing software on my Chromebook?

    You can easily install editing software on your Chromebook by visiting the Chrome Web Store and searching for the desired software. Once you find it, click Add to Chrome and follow the instructions to complete the installation.
